## Releases

Welcome aboard! Quieten, our on-call alert deduplicator, ships every other Thursday. We cut a tag from main, run the smoke suite against the Farwick staging cluster, and push artifacts to the internal registry. If you're doing the release, ping whoever's on rotation first — usually Marla or Deet — so nobody double-cuts. Hotfixes skip the schedule but still need a signed build; unsigned tarballs get rejected at deploy time, no exceptions. To verify any release artifact locally, use the current signing key below.

signing key of yagug-bawif = bky9_cvCf6ehGp

The existing index on `suggestions.term` only supports prefix lookups, so mid-word queries degrade badly past a few million rows. The change adds a trigram index plus a query rewrite in `suggest_repo.py`; please review both together, since the rewrite assumes the index exists. To reproduce the regression locally, run `make load-fixtures` to populate roughly two million sample terms, then benchmark with `make bench-suggest`. The fixture loader targets the database described by the string below.

primary connection of yagep-kahip = redis://giliel_svc:zYiKsLL2PLpfPL@db-348f.xolmarsys.corp:5432/fenwyn

## Markform Environments

Markform is the markdown rendering pipeline behind Quillbase's doc viewer. It runs in three environments: dev, staging, and prod. Each environment pins its own sanitizer ruleset and plugin allowlist, so a renderer change must be verified per environment before promotion. Staging mirrors prod traffic at 10% sampling, which is usually enough to catch escaping regressions. When reviewing a change, confirm the values below match what the deploy manifest expects. The current staging configuration is as follows.

settings of fafog-haduf:
ZORIX_PIN=4648
ZORIX_METRICS_HOST=metrics.zorix.paliqsys.corp
ZORIX_LOG_LEVEL=info
ZORIX_TENANT=druix